Brevard County, Florida is classified under IECC Climate Zone 2A (Hot - Humid), a cooling-dominated region with humid moisture conditions. With 47 ZIP codes and 1 communities, every HVAC installation in Brevard County must use the ASHRAE design temperatures of 40°F (99% winter heating) and 93°F (1% summer cooling) for accurate Manual J load calculations.
As a cooling-dominated zone, controlling solar heat gain is essential in Brevard County. Windows must have an SHGC of 0.25 or lower, along with R-13 wall and R-30 ceiling insulation. Proper sizing prevents oversized AC systems that short-cycle and waste energy.
Minimum insulation R-values and window performance for Climate Zone 2A in Brevard County, FL.
| Building Component | Minimum Requirement | Unit |
|---|---|---|
| Ceiling / Attic Insulation | R-30 | R-value |
| Wall Insulation | R-13 | R-value |
| Floor Insulation | R-13 | R-value |
| Window U-Factor | 0.4 | BTU/hr-ft²-°F |
| Window SHGC | 0.25 | Coefficient |
| Air Infiltration | 0.25 | ACH50 |
